As a Senior Specialist in Fixed Income Service , you will support clients in making informed investment decisions by providing guidance, education, and solutions across fixed income products. In this role, you will handle inbound client calls, provide consultative support for clients aligned to their goals, and execute a combination of solicited and unsolicited fixed income trades for clients. You provide expertise on fixed income investments including U.S. Treasuries, certificates of deposits, municipal bonds, corporate bonds, government agency bonds, and preferred securities.
